An intriguing pre-Columbian / Mexico Mayan terracotta pottery standing figure that appears to be holding a water jug on top of head. Could be a ceremonial figure, celebrating the abundance of water. Circa Late Classic Period. From a private collection. Dimensions: 7.5”h x 4”w x 1.5”d. In good condition consistent with age.
